WH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

434 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Wyndham Hotels & Resorts (WH)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$7.02B — down 7.8% from $7.62B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 60 funds opened new WH positions and 41 closed out — a net gain of 19 holders — while 146 added to existing stakes and 137 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Nuveen, adding an estimated $65.6M. The largest seller was Massachusetts Financial Services, exiting entirely with an estimated $184M sold.
